Output ae8ebbf6dd224a9b499d89dc640babf82b0b5881afdcb01e761c24baa7544e9a:128

value
113997
script pubkey
OP_0 OP_PUSHBYTES_20 fcfaa453317e2e880f8f58f25a0fe492a4567374
address
bc1qlna2g5e30chgsru0tre95rlyj2j9vum5xpt56k
transaction
ae8ebbf6dd224a9b499d89dc640babf82b0b5881afdcb01e761c24baa7544e9a
confirmations
26267
spent
true